Income Tax Deduction for Financial Institutions FAQ


What is the Income Tax Deduction for Financial Institutions?

The Illinois Income Tax Act 35 ILCS 5/203 provides that financial institutions in Illinois, such as banks and savings and loans, are eligible for a special deduction from their Illinois corporate income tax return. Such institutions may deduct from their taxable income an amount equal to the interest received from a loan for development in an enterprise zone. This is limited to the interest earned on loans or portions of loans secured by property which is eligible for the enterprise zone investment tax credit, described on Page 2 of this publication. Please refer to the section on the investment tax credit for a definition of eligible property.
